haven't been to a concert since bet experience june 2014. shyt was dope though.

khaled was the host.

ty dolla opened it, thought it was disrespectful because the place was still empty and he was the only one from actually from LA. his set was dope though, the little crowd that was there enjoyed it.

rich homie quan did a few songs, his shyt was dope crowd rocked to it.

august asilina was next, his shyt was crickets, nobody was checking for him.

rick ross was next. i'm not a fan but he has enough hits to where his shyt was dope.


asap rocky was next. nobody cared about his shyt and it was frustrating him, one of his records skipped and he got mad and refused to do "bad bytches". only time crowd was into his shyt was when they did shabba ranks.

outkast was the headliner. came out to the goat intro by khaled, "when i say outkast you say.... outkast?":mjlol: they shyt was dope, everybody was into it. they brought out slick rick for art of storytellin, bun b for intl players anthem, and killer mike for the whole world. overall shyt was dope.
